Rebound Financial Renews Lease at 610 Woodruff
Rebound Financial renewed their 525 square feet of office space in 610 Woodruff located at 610-640 S. Woodruff Avenue in Idaho Falls. Dustin Mortimer of TOK Commercial facilitated the transaction for the tenant and landlord.